In my small office (30ish staff) we're starting to look at steps we can take to increase awareness about energy efficiency/ sustainability and to promote behaviour change. Our first pilot project is to reduce the garbage we produce from snacks & lunches. Located in a happening commercial area, we have a plethora of take-out options, and most folk choose to purchase rather than bring lunch from home. We've had great success with local businesses agreeing to allow us to bring reusable containers, which we label with tare weight and portion sizes. Can anyone point me in the direction of studies/ projects/ prompts/ etc. for this subject?
